Classic and Timeless Designs
Often called "Old School", this style is characterized by heavy outlines and a limited color palette, typically featuring primary colors. You'll often see roses, anchors, eagles, and skulls. These procreate tattoo stencil are famous for their clarity over time, looking fantastic for decades.
Understated and Structured Tattoos
For those who prefer a more understated look, minimalist tattoos are an perfect choice. They emphasize fine lines, simple shapes, and a clean aesthetic. Geometric tattoos fall into this category, using symmetrical patterns like circles, triangles, and mandalas to create appealing procreate tattoo stencil. These are ideal for a discreet yet meaningful piece of art.
Artistic Ink Wash Styles
A modern trend, watercolor tattoos mimic the look of a painting. They feature soft color blending, splatters, and a an absence of solid black outlines. This technique creates a beautifully free-flowing effect on the skin. This style is wonderful for artistic and unique procreate tattoo stencil.
